Important features for professionals and roommates

Professional renters often prioritize commute convenience and flexible leasing options. Look for properties that are near major highways or public transit links to reduce travel time. Modern apartments typically include in unit laundry, high speed internet readiness, and sufficient storage. Shared amenities like a fitness center, coworking lounge, and secure package handling can transform a simple rental into a practical home base for changing work patterns. Noise control, pet friendly policies, and transparent community rules help maintain a respectful living environment for all residents.

Tips to compare options efficiently

Make a concise checklist before touring properties. Compare rent levels, security deposits, and included services such as water, trash, and lawn care. Ask about renewal incentives and any upcoming community improvements that could affect your budget. Request a recent resident survey or reviews to gauge satisfaction with maintenance response times and management quality. If you have specific needs like accessibility features or family friendly layouts, note them early to ensure the floor plans you visit align with your preferences. Being prepared helps you move with confidence.
